1. What is a Horsepower from 1/4 Mile Time Calculator?

Definition: This calculator estimates a vehicle's horsepower based on its weight and 1/4 mile elapsed time.

Purpose: It helps automotive enthusiasts and professionals estimate engine power without dyno testing.

2. How Does the Calculator Work?

The calculator uses the formula:

\[ HP = \frac{W}{(ET / 5.825)^3} \]

Where:

Explanation: The formula relates a vehicle's acceleration performance (1/4 mile time) to its power-to-weight ratio.

5. Frequently Asked Questions (FAQ)

Q1: How accurate is this estimation?
A: It provides a rough estimate; actual dyno results may vary by ±10% due to traction, aerodynamics, and other factors.

Q2: Should I use curb weight or race weight?
A: For most accurate results, use the actual weight during the run (including driver and fuel).

Q3: Does this account for drivetrain loss?
A: No, this estimates wheel horsepower. For engine horsepower, add ~15% for RWD, ~20% for FWD, ~25% for AWD.

Q4: What's the 5.825 constant?
A: This empirical constant relates acceleration performance to power-to-weight ratio based on statistical analysis of drag racing data.

Q5: Can I use this for motorcycles?
A: Yes, but results may be less accurate for very light vehicles with high power-to-weight ratios.
